Carbon is found in large amounts in coal. It is a key component of coal along with other elements such as hydrogen, sulfur, and oxygen.
Anthracite coal contains the most carbon compared to other types of coal such as bituminous and lignite. Anthracite coal has a carbon content ranging from 86% to 98%.

Some names of German coal regions include the Ruhr Basin (Ruhrgebiet), Saarland, and the Rhineland. These regions have historically been significant for coal mining and have played a crucial role in Germany's industrial development.

Coal is mined in Kalabagh, many areas of Baluchistan and Punjab. The largest reserves of coal have been found in Thar, the largest desert of Pakistan. These reserves are also termed as Thar Coal.
